    Wood is a better rim protector, rebounder, pick/roll, shooter, and scoring efficiency.

    Simmons is a better ball handler, on ball defender, and passer.

    Simmons limitations mean you, like with Westbrook, have to adjust the players around him to utilize him. Wood can pretty much plug and play anywhere. Simmons negatively impacts his team because they can pack the paint and limit his teammates opportunities unless they can all shoot to create lanes for Simmons. You can't post him up with a big in the paint because the help defense is too close and passing lanes not clear.

    It's not just Simmons talent vs. Wood's talent. It's Simmons (skills + contract) vs Wood (skills + contract). Wood could probably be re-signed with less money than Simmon's current deal.

    Simmons also kills spacing, the offensive system will have to be re-designed. Is team building around JGreen / Al-P / (Maybe a Holmgren | Banchero) or a Simmons.
